How to Evaluate AI Model Accuracy Metrics: Complete Guide to Measuring Performance in 2026
Master AI model evaluation with our comprehensive guide to accuracy metrics. Learn classification, regression, and advanced techniques for 2026 success.
How to Evaluate AI Model Accuracy Metrics: Complete Guide to Measuring Performance in 2026
Evaluating how to evaluate AI model accuracy metrics is crucial for building reliable AI systems that deliver consistent results in production environments. In 2026, as artificial intelligence becomes increasingly integrated into business operations, understanding these metrics has become essential for data scientists, ML engineers, and business leaders alike.
The ability to properly assess model performance determines whether your AI initiatives succeed or fail. With recent studies from MIT showing that poorly evaluated models can lead to significant business losses, mastering these evaluation techniques is more important than ever.
Why AI Model Accuracy Metrics Matter in 2026
AI model accuracy metrics serve as the foundation for making informed decisions about model deployment and optimization. These metrics help you:
- Validate model reliability before production deployment
- Compare different algorithms to select the best performer
- Identify potential bias and fairness issues
- Monitor model degradation over time
- Communicate results effectively to stakeholders
According to Gartner’s 2025 AI Trends Report, organizations that implement comprehensive model evaluation frameworks are 3.2 times more likely to achieve successful AI deployments.
Core Classification Metrics Every Data Scientist Should Know
Accuracy: The Foundation Metric
Accuracy represents the percentage of correct predictions out of total predictions. While intuitive, accuracy alone can be misleading, especially with imbalanced datasets.
Formula: Accuracy = (True Positives + True Negatives) / Total Predictions
When to use: Balanced datasets where all classes are equally important
Limitations: Can be misleading with class imbalance (e.g., 95% accuracy on a dataset with 95% negative examples isn’t impressive)
Precision and Recall: The Quality vs Quantity Trade-off
Precision measures how many selected items are relevant:
- Formula: Precision = True Positives / (True Positives + False Positives)
- High precision means low false positive rate
- Critical for applications where false positives are costly (e.g., spam detection)
Recall measures how many relevant items are selected:
- Formula: Recall = True Positives / (True Positives + False Negatives)
- High recall means low false negative rate
- Essential for applications where missing positives is dangerous (e.g., medical diagnosis)
F1-Score: Balancing Precision and Recall
The F1-score provides a single metric that balances precision and recall:
Formula: F1 = 2 × (Precision × Recall) / (Precision + Recall)
Benefits:
- Useful for imbalanced datasets
- Single metric for model comparison
- Harmonic mean prevents one metric from dominating
Area Under the ROC Curve (AUC-ROC)
AUC-ROC measures the model’s ability to distinguish between classes across all classification thresholds.
Key points:
- Values range from 0 to 1 (higher is better)
- 0.5 indicates random performance
- Excellent for binary classification problems
- Less effective with highly imbalanced datasets
When training machine learning models for beginners, understanding these fundamental metrics forms the cornerstone of model evaluation.
Advanced Metrics for Complex Scenarios
Matthews Correlation Coefficient (MCC)
MCC provides a balanced measure even with imbalanced datasets:
Formula: MCC = (TP×TN - FP×FN) / √[(TP+FP)(TP+FN)(TN+FP)(TN+FN)]
Advantages:
- Ranges from -1 to +1
- Considers all confusion matrix elements
- Reliable for imbalanced datasets
Cohen’s Kappa
Kappa measures inter-rater agreement, accounting for chance agreement:
Interpretation:
- κ < 0: Poor agreement
- 0 ≤ κ < 0.20: Slight agreement
- 0.20 ≤ κ < 0.40: Fair agreement
- 0.40 ≤ κ < 0.60: Moderate agreement
- 0.60 ≤ κ < 0.80: Substantial agreement
- κ ≥ 0.80: Almost perfect agreement
Class-Specific Metrics
For multi-class problems, calculate metrics for each class:
- Macro-average: Calculate metric for each class, then average
- Micro-average: Calculate metric globally across all classes
- Weighted average: Weight metrics by class support
Regression Model Evaluation Metrics
Mean Absolute Error (MAE)
MAE measures average absolute differences between predicted and actual values:
Formula: MAE = Σ|yi - ŷi| / n
Characteristics:
- Easy to interpret (same units as target variable)
- Robust to outliers
- All errors weighted equally
Root Mean Square Error (RMSE)
RMSE penalizes larger errors more heavily:
Formula: RMSE = √[Σ(yi - ŷi)² / n]
When to use:
- When large errors are particularly problematic
- Comparing models with different scales
- Want to penalize outliers more severely
R-squared (Coefficient of Determination)
R² measures the proportion of variance explained by the model:
Formula: R² = 1 - (SS_res / SS_tot)
Interpretation:
- Values range from 0 to 1
- Higher values indicate better fit
- Can be negative for very poor models
Mean Absolute Percentage Error (MAPE)
MAPE expresses error as a percentage:
Formula: MAPE = (100/n) × Σ|yi - ŷi|/yi
Advantages:
- Scale-independent
- Easy to interpret for business stakeholders
- Good for comparing models across different datasets
Specialized Metrics for Different AI Applications
Natural Language Processing Metrics
When working with natural language processing applications, specialized metrics become crucial:
BLEU Score (for translation tasks):
- Measures n-gram overlap between predicted and reference text
- Ranges from 0 to 1 (higher is better)
- Standard for machine translation evaluation
ROUGE Score (for summarization):
- Recall-oriented metric for text summarization
- Multiple variants: ROUGE-N, ROUGE-L, ROUGE-S
- Compares generated summaries to reference summaries
Computer Vision Metrics
For computer vision applications, consider these metrics:
Intersection over Union (IoU):
- Measures overlap between predicted and ground truth bounding boxes
- Essential for object detection tasks
- Threshold typically set at 0.5 for positive detection
Mean Average Precision (mAP):
- Combines precision and recall across different IoU thresholds
- Standard metric for object detection competitions
- Provides comprehensive performance assessment
Cross-Validation Strategies for Robust Evaluation
K-Fold Cross-Validation
K-fold CV provides more reliable performance estimates:
- Split data into k equal folds
- Train on k-1 folds, test on remaining fold
- Repeat k times, rotating test fold
- Average results across all folds
Benefits:
- Reduces overfitting to specific train/test splits
- Provides confidence intervals for performance metrics
- More efficient use of available data
Stratified Cross-Validation
For classification problems with imbalanced classes:
- Maintains class proportions across all folds
- Ensures each fold is representative of the overall dataset
- Particularly important for rare class problems
Time Series Cross-Validation
For temporal data:
- Forward chaining: Use past data to predict future
- Rolling window: Maintain constant training window size
- Expanding window: Gradually increase training data
According to research from Stanford’s AI Lab, proper cross-validation can improve model reliability by up to 40% compared to simple train/test splits.
Statistical Significance and Confidence Intervals
Testing Statistical Significance
Ensure observed performance differences are meaningful:
McNemar’s Test (for classification):
- Tests whether two models have significantly different error rates
- Uses paired samples from the same dataset
- Provides p-values for significance testing
Paired t-test (for regression):
- Compares mean squared errors between models
- Accounts for variance in performance across samples
- Standard approach for comparing regression models
Bootstrap Confidence Intervals
Bootstrap resampling provides confidence intervals for metrics:
- Resample dataset with replacement
- Calculate metric on each bootstrap sample
- Generate distribution of metric values
- Calculate confidence intervals from distribution
Model Performance Monitoring in Production
Tracking Metric Degradation
Once models are deployed, continuous monitoring becomes essential:
Data Drift Detection:
- Monitor input feature distributions
- Use statistical tests (KS test, chi-square test)
- Set alerts for significant distribution changes
Concept Drift Detection:
- Track prediction accuracy over time
- Use sliding window approaches
- Implement automated retraining triggers
A/B Testing for Model Evaluation
Compare model versions in production:
- Split traffic between model versions
- Track business metrics alongside technical metrics
- Use statistical tests to determine significance
- Gradually roll out winning models
When implementing AI in business, establishing these monitoring practices early prevents costly model failures.
Choosing the Right Metrics for Your Use Case
Business Context Considerations
Cost of Errors:
- High false positive cost → Optimize for precision
- High false negative cost → Optimize for recall
- Balanced costs → Use F1-score or accuracy
Stakeholder Requirements:
- Non-technical stakeholders → Use interpretable metrics (accuracy, MAPE)
- Technical teams → Can handle complex metrics (AUC-ROC, MCC)
- Regulatory compliance → May require specific metrics
Dataset Characteristics
Class Balance:
- Balanced datasets → Accuracy is appropriate
- Imbalanced datasets → Use precision/recall, F1-score, or MCC
Sample Size:
- Large datasets → Most metrics are reliable
- Small datasets → Use cross-validation, bootstrap confidence intervals
Data Quality:
- Clean data → Standard metrics apply
- Noisy data → Consider robust metrics, outlier handling
Tools and Frameworks for Metric Evaluation
Python Libraries
Scikit-learn:
from sklearn.metrics import accuracy_score, classification_report
from sklearn.model_selection import cross_val_score
TensorFlow/Keras:
model.compile(optimizer='adam', loss='binary_crossentropy', metrics=['accuracy', 'precision', 'recall'])
PyTorch:
from torchmetrics import Accuracy, F1Score, AUROC
Specialized Tools
When selecting AI development platforms, consider built-in evaluation capabilities:
- MLflow: Experiment tracking and model registry
- Weights & Biases: Advanced visualization and comparison
- Neptune: Metadata management and collaboration
- TensorBoard: Deep learning model visualization
Cloud-Based Solutions
AWS SageMaker:
- Built-in model evaluation capabilities
- Automatic hyperparameter tuning
- Model monitoring and drift detection
Google Cloud AI Platform:
- What-if analysis tools
- Fairness indicators
- Continuous evaluation pipelines
Azure Machine Learning:
- Responsible AI dashboard
- Model interpretability features
- Automated model comparison
Common Pitfalls and How to Avoid Them
Data Leakage
Problem: Future information included in training data
Solutions:
- Strict temporal splits for time series data
- Careful feature engineering
- Domain expert review of features
Evaluation on Training Data
Problem: Overly optimistic performance estimates
Solutions:
- Always use held-out test sets
- Implement proper cross-validation
- Never tune hyperparameters on test data
Cherry-Picking Metrics
Problem: Selecting metrics that make models look better
Solutions:
- Define evaluation criteria before modeling
- Report multiple complementary metrics
- Consider business context in metric selection
Ignoring Class Imbalance
Problem: High accuracy on imbalanced datasets can be misleading
Solutions:
- Use stratified sampling
- Report class-specific metrics
- Consider cost-sensitive evaluation
Advanced Evaluation Techniques for 2026
Fairness and Bias Assessment
With increasing focus on preventing AI bias, evaluation must include fairness metrics:
Demographic Parity:
- Equal positive prediction rates across groups
- P(Ŷ = 1 | A = 0) = P(Ŷ = 1 | A = 1)
Equalized Odds:
- Equal true positive and false positive rates
- Important for criminal justice applications
Individual Fairness:
- Similar individuals receive similar predictions
- Requires careful definition of similarity
Explainability Metrics
As AI systems become more complex, explainability evaluation becomes crucial:
LIME (Local Interpretable Model-agnostic Explanations):
- Explains individual predictions
- Model-agnostic approach
- Useful for debugging model behavior
SHAP (SHapley Additive exPlanations):
- Unified framework for model explanation
- Theoretically grounded in game theory
- Provides both local and global explanations
Uncertainty Quantification
Modern AI systems must express confidence in their predictions:
Calibration Assessment:
- Reliability diagrams
- Expected Calibration Error (ECE)
- Maximum Calibration Error (MCE)
Prediction Intervals:
- Quantile regression for confidence bounds
- Conformal prediction for distribution-free intervals
- Bayesian approaches for uncertainty estimation
Industry-Specific Evaluation Standards
Healthcare AI
- FDA approval requirements for medical devices
- Clinical trial standards for validation
- HIPAA compliance for data handling
- Sensitivity analysis for critical decisions
Financial Services
- Model risk management frameworks
- Regulatory stress testing requirements
- Fair lending compliance metrics
- Backtesting standards for trading models
Autonomous Systems
- Safety-critical evaluation protocols
- Real-world testing requirements
- Edge case handling assessment
- Human-AI interaction metrics
Future Trends in AI Model Evaluation
Automated Evaluation Pipelines
In 2026, we’re seeing increased adoption of:
- Continuous integration for ML (CI/ML)
- Automated model validation pipelines
- Real-time performance monitoring
- Intelligent alerting systems
Federated Learning Evaluation
As federated learning grows, new evaluation challenges emerge:
- Privacy-preserving evaluation techniques
- Cross-institutional validation protocols
- Heterogeneous data distribution handling
- Communication-efficient evaluation
Multi-Modal Model Assessment
With the rise of multi-modal AI:
- Cross-modal consistency metrics
- Modality-specific evaluation approaches
- Fusion effectiveness measurement
- Resource efficiency assessment
As organizations increasingly measure AI ROI, these advanced evaluation techniques become essential for demonstrating business value.
Implementing Evaluation Best Practices
Establishing Evaluation Frameworks
- Define success criteria before model development
- Create standardized evaluation pipelines
- Document evaluation procedures thoroughly
- Establish baseline models for comparison
- Implement version control for evaluation scripts
Building Evaluation Teams
Key roles:
- Data scientists: Technical metric implementation
- Domain experts: Business context and interpretation
- ML engineers: Production monitoring systems
- Compliance officers: Regulatory requirement adherence
Continuous Learning and Improvement
- Regular evaluation method reviews
- Industry benchmark participation
- Conference and workshop attendance
- Cross-team knowledge sharing
- External consultant engagement
According to McKinsey’s 2025 AI Report, organizations with mature evaluation practices are 2.5 times more likely to achieve successful AI transformations.
Conclusion
Mastering how to evaluate AI model accuracy metrics is essential for building reliable AI systems in 2026. From fundamental classification metrics like precision and recall to advanced techniques for fairness and uncertainty quantification, comprehensive evaluation ensures your models perform reliably in production.
Key takeaways:
- Choose metrics aligned with your business objectives and use case
- Use multiple complementary metrics rather than relying on single measures
- Implement robust cross-validation strategies for reliable estimates
- Monitor model performance continuously in production
- Consider fairness and explainability alongside traditional accuracy metrics
- Stay current with evolving evaluation best practices
As AI continues to transform industries, organizations that excel at model evaluation will have a significant competitive advantage. The techniques outlined in this guide provide a comprehensive foundation for building evaluation expertise that will serve you well in 2026 and beyond.
What are the most important AI model accuracy metrics for beginners?
For beginners, start with these fundamental metrics:
- Accuracy: Overall correctness percentage
- Precision: Quality of positive predictions
- Recall: Coverage of actual positives
- F1-Score: Balance between precision and recall
- Mean Absolute Error (MAE): For regression problems
These provide a solid foundation before moving to more advanced metrics like AUC-ROC or Matthews Correlation Coefficient.
How do I choose the right evaluation metric for my AI model?
Choose metrics based on:
- Problem type: Classification vs. regression vs. ranking
- Business context: Cost of false positives vs. false negatives
- Data characteristics: Balanced vs. imbalanced datasets
- Stakeholder needs: Technical team vs. business executives
- Regulatory requirements: Industry-specific compliance needs
For example, use precision for spam detection (minimize false positives) and recall for medical diagnosis (minimize false negatives).
What’s the difference between accuracy and F1-score?
Accuracy measures overall correctness: (TP + TN) / Total Predictions F1-score balances precision and recall: 2 × (Precision × Recall) / (Precision + Recall)
F1-score is better for:
- Imbalanced datasets
- When you care about both false positives and false negatives
- Comparing models with different precision/recall trade-offs
Accuracy works well for balanced datasets where all classes are equally important.
How can I evaluate AI model performance with imbalanced datasets?
For imbalanced datasets, avoid accuracy and use:
- F1-score: Balances precision and recall
- Matthews Correlation Coefficient (MCC): Considers all confusion matrix elements
- Area Under Precision-Recall Curve (AUC-PR): Better than ROC for imbalanced data
- Class-specific metrics: Precision/recall for each class
- Stratified cross-validation: Maintains class proportions
Also consider cost-sensitive evaluation and sampling techniques like SMOTE.
What are the best practices for cross-validation in AI model evaluation?
Cross-validation best practices include:
- Use stratified k-fold for classification problems
- Use time-series splits for temporal data
- Set k=5 or k=10 for most problems
- Repeat cross-validation multiple times for stability
- Don’t tune hyperparameters on test data
- Use nested cross-validation for hyperparameter tuning
- Report confidence intervals with mean performance
- Consider computational cost vs. reliability trade-offs
How do I monitor AI model accuracy in production?
Production monitoring involves:
- Real-time metric tracking: Accuracy, precision, recall over time
- Data drift detection: Monitor input feature distributions
- Concept drift detection: Track prediction-outcome relationships
- A/B testing: Compare model versions with statistical significance
- Automated alerts: Set thresholds for metric degradation
- Regular retraining: Update models when performance drops
- Business metric correlation: Link technical metrics to business outcomes
Use tools like MLflow, Weights & Biases, or cloud-based monitoring services for comprehensive tracking.